In Re City Build (London) Ltd (in liquidation) [2022] EWHC 364 (Ch), the Court confirmed that the burden of proof in directors' duties cases, and in cases alleging a transaction at an undervalue, lies with the applicant.

In cases such as this, directors do not bear the burden of proof. Applicants must provide sufficient evidence to prove their case.
